Psalm 88

   

A Petition to Be Saved from Death.

A Song. A Psalm of the sons of Korah. For the choir director; according to Mahalath Leannoth. A Maskil of Heman the Ezrahite.

  border
Psalm 88:1   O LORD, the God of my salvation, I have cried out by day and in the night before You.
   
Psalm 88:2   Let my prayer come before You; Incline Your ear to my cry!
   
Psalm 88:3   For my soul has had enough troubles, And my life has drawn near to Sheol.
   
Psalm 88:4   I am reckoned among those who go down to the pit; I have become like a man without strength,
   
Psalm 88:5   Forsaken among the dead, Like the slain who lie in the grave, Whom You remember no more, And they are cut off from Your hand.
   
Psalm 88:6   You have put me in the lowest pit, In dark places, in the depths.
   
Psalm 88:7   Your wrath has rested upon me, And You have afflicted me with all Your waves. Selah.
   
Psalm 88:8   You have removed my acquaintances far from me; You have made me an object of loathing to them; I am shut up and cannot go out.
   
Psalm 88:9   My eye has wasted away because of affliction; I have called upon You every day, O LORD; I have spread out my hands to You.
   
Psalm 88:10   Will You perform wonders for the dead? Will the departed spirits rise and praise You? Selah.
   
Psalm 88:11   Will Your lovingkindness be declared in the grave, Your faithfulness in Abaddon?
   
Psalm 88:12   Will Your wonders be made known in the darkness? And Your righteousness in the land of forgetfulness?
   
Psalm 88:13   But I, O LORD, have cried out to You for help, And in the morning my prayer comes before You.
   
Psalm 88:14   O LORD, why do You reject my soul? Why do You hide Your face from me?
   
Psalm 88:15   I was afflicted and about to die from my youth on; I suffer Your terrors; I am overcome.
   
Psalm 88:16   Your burning anger has passed over me; Your terrors have destroyed me.
   
Psalm 88:17   They have surrounded me like water all day long; They have encompassed me altogether.
   
Psalm 88:18   You have removed lover and friend far from me; My acquaintances are in darkness.
